About Temperature Sensors - Thermostats - Solid State


Solid-state temperature sensors and thermostats are electronic devices used to measure and control temperature in various applications. These sensors rely on semiconductor materials and solid-state electronics to detect temperature changes and provide accurate temperature readings. Solid-state temperature sensors offer advantages such as high accuracy, fast response times, and reliability compared to traditional thermocouples or bi-metallic thermostats.
